Index of Subjects Hi Steve, I don't use MS Word nor have I have seen any problem reports of others using that program with Firefox. I constantly import/export text and information from WordPad to and from Yahoo using Firefox with no problem. Try saving the document first to a plain text file and then accessing it with Firefox to see if it's a print format problem. It's possible that MS Word's proprietary .doc format may not allow programs such as Firefox easy access, but that is just a guess. If that's the problem then Microsoft may be requiring users to use IE only with MS Word .doc files but I can't really see that being the case as that would be counterproductive for even Microsoft, with their already ongoing notoriety over non-competitive browser problems. You could try asking on the internet newsgroup: 24hoursupport.helpdesk, which I find is populated by gurus who seem to have a lot of knowledge on programs and problems and I have never failed to get at least a lead to follow regarding a problem, regardless of obscurity. It may just be a minor patch, fix or setting adjustment. Also, if you were to ask at: www.mozilla.com (makers of Firefox), they might have an answer for you if it's a known problem.
